A leading global company in Greater London is looking for a member of their Global Office Management team. You will oversee office operations, manage service contracts, and ensure compliance with sustainability standards.
The ideal candidate should have 3-5 years of experience in a service-oriented role and possess strong organizational skills. A proactive and client-focused approach is essential for welcoming guests and supporting environmental initiatives.
This role comes with benefits like a flexible four-day work week and various health initiatives.
